Ingersoll Rand to acquire Trane for $10.1 billion
Ingersoll Rand signed a definitive agreement to acquire Trane Inc. (formerly American Standard Companies) in a cash-and-stock deal valued at approximately $10.1 billion, including the assumption of debt. The transaction was expected to close in early 2008.
“Ingersoll Rand announced that it has executed a definitive agreement to acquire Trane Inc., formerly American Standard Companies Inc., in a transaction valued at approximately $10.1 billion, including transaction fees and the assumption of approximately $150 million of Trane net debt.”
